Output 85f3ff08b7e7eef4a3e488e5ee135cf92fc4cc544c3133694319f155048b08f3:3

value
31091611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66633c7eaf079bd859bbb39922245b7a327714e OP_EQUAL
address
MWMztkxHWxgY5R3UsWhtMUqcbpxm6czdda
transaction
85f3ff08b7e7eef4a3e488e5ee135cf92fc4cc544c3133694319f155048b08f3
spent
true